For those doctors looking to strike out to open their own clinic - where do they get their first pot of gold to build up the capital for rental, medical equipment, pharmacy, admin aunties etc?

Do they just work for many years and save? Borrow from fam? Or does some PE or fund usually back these aspirants?

Talking about doctors in probably internal medicine in restructured hospitals and jumping out to open their own clinic - be it GP clinic or specialist clinic or even paediatrician?
Used to be work and save.
But with the very slow increase in salaries but massive increase in rental costs and property costs nowadays it is almost impossible to save for it.
Need investors. Seed money.
Getting harder unfortunately.
